This opportunity is for an experienced CVOR Surgical Tech to support advanced cardiovascular and general surgical procedures in a well-equipped, Level 1 Trauma teaching hospital. The role requires in-depth knowledge of cardiovascular, orthopedic, neurosurgical, and general surgical cases and demands a professional skilled in fast-paced, high-acuity clinical environments.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ist in complex surgical procedures including open heart surgery, valve replacements, vascular, orthopedic, neuro, and general surgeries.
- Operate sophisticated medical technologies such as EPIC Optime EMR, Alaris IV pumps, Pyxis medication dispensing, and Phillips monitors.
- Collaborate effectively with the surgical team to maintain patient safety, uphold sterile techniques, and optimize OR flow.
- Participate in on-call rotations including holiday coverage, with 6-9 call shifts monthly.
- Complete unit-specific orientation to familiarize with institutional protocols and equipment.
Qualifications and Experience:
- Minimum 2 years of General OR experience plus 5 years in CVOR preferred; consideration given to those with strong surgical backgrounds.
- Completion of an accredited surgical technologist program preferred; Certified Surgical Technologist (CST) designation is advantageous.
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required;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) recommended.
- High level of clinical judgment and ability to adapt in critical, time-sensitive situations.
Schedule:
- 10-hour day shifts from 7 AM to 5 PM.
- Six-week scheduling cycle with holiday and on-call responsibilities.
